Zusammenfassung: | Neutron diffraction has been used to re-examine the low-temperature magnetic structure of Ho. Distortions of the mangnetic structures are found due to interactions of trigonal symmetry, both of the one spin-sip and cone phases. The transition between these phases is showns to occur in two distinct steps. |
